Using Healthy Start – Get help to buy food and milk (Healthy Start)

(4 days ago) WEBCan I use my Healthy Start card for online shopping? No. However, the Healthy Start card can be used in any shop that sells healthy food and milk and accepts Mastercard®. No, the card can only be used in store. You cannot purchase more than the balance on your card. You can check your balance at an ATM or by calling us on 0300 330 7010

Learn about the rules of the NHS Healthy Start scheme

(5 days ago) WEBYou can split payments between your Healthy Start card and your normal bank card or cash. Some shops will need to do this as separate transactions. At self-checkout machines, you can only split payments between your Healthy Start card and cash, not another bank card. keep your card and PIN safe ; check your balance at a cashpoint or by

Healthy Start SSBC

(2 days ago) WEBYou can get a Healthy Start card if you: are at least 10 weeks pregnant or. have a child under four years old. Your family must also get at least one of the following: Income Support. Income-based Jobseeker’s Allowance. Income-related Employment and Support Allowance. Child Tax Credit with a family income of £16,190 or less per year.

Healthy Start — Citizens Advice Greater Manchester

(1 days ago) WEBYou can use your Healthy Start card to buy healthy foods on their own or with other shopping. You cannot spend more than the balance of the card. If you want to make a contactless payment, the first time you use your card you’ll need to insert your card and use your PIN. After that, you can make contactless payments of up to £45.

Using your Best Start Foods card - mygov.scot

(5 days ago) WEBBest Start Foods is paid to help you buy healthy foods for you and your baby. These foods are: plain cow's milk. first infant formula. fresh, frozen or tinned fruit or vegetables. fresh or dried pulses like lentils, beans, peas and barley. fresh eggs. These foods are also listed on the back of your Best Start Foods card.
